Specific embodiment
Below by the description to embodiment, the shape of for example related each component of specific embodiment of the present utility model Shape, construction, the mutual alignment between each section and connection relationship, the effect of each section and working principle, manufacturing process and operation Application method etc., is described in further detail, to help inventive concept of the those skilled in the art to the utility model, technology Scheme has more complete, accurate and deep understanding.
A kind of sewage-treatment plant, including sewage pump 1, water pretreatment component 2, filter assemblies 3 and water purification detach component 4, Sewage pump 1, water pretreatment component 2 and filter assemblies 3 are sequentially connected by water pipe, and water purification detaches component 4 and is mounted on filter assemblies 3 On, filter assemblies 3 include water-purifying tank 31, and spiral filtration pipe 32 is equipped in water-purifying tank 31, and spiral filtration pipe 32 is equipped with water inlet Mouth 321, water inlet 321 penetrates through the upper side wall of water-purifying tank 31 and extends outwardly, on water inlet 321 by snap connection means It is connected with water inlet pipe 33, water inlet pipe 33 extends into water pretreatment component 2, and booster pump 34 is equipped on water inlet pipe 33.In use, Sewage is pumped into water pretreatment component 2 by sewage pump 1, and water is evacuated to spiral filtration pipe by booster pump 34 after pretreatment by sewage In 32, sewage does centrifugal movement under the promotion of booster pump 34 in spiral filtration pipe 32, and water purification is got rid of out of spiral filtration pipe 32 Enter water-purifying tank 31 out, the sundries in water stays in spiral filtration pipe 32, and filtered water purification detaches component 4 by water purification and extracts out only Bucket 31 utilizes again, this setting carries out secondary filter to sewage, improves the filter effect of sewage, sewage is in spiral filtration pipe Centrifugal movement is done in 32 can optimize the separating effect of water and impurity in sewage, and then improve filter effect.
Water pretreatment component 2 include plus bacterium unit with mix sedimentation unit, add bacterium unit to be connected with sewage pump 1, add bacterium Unit is connected with mixing sedimentation unit by water pipe, and mixing sedimentation unit is connected with water inlet pipe 33.Wherein, add bacterium unit pair Sewage carries out biochemical treatment, and organic pollutant is transformed into harmless gaseous product, product liquid and consolidating rich in organic matter Body product, extra biological sludge precipitate in mixing sedimentation unit, realize and be separated by solid-liquid separation, and sewage is located in this setting in advance Reason, separated from contaminants most in sewage is come out, the operating pressure of filter assemblies 3 is alleviated, improves filter assemblies 3 Service life.
Bacterium unit is added to include mixing tube 21 and add bacterium device 22, mixing tube 21 is connected with sewage pump 1, peace in mixing tube 21 Equipped with pipe-line mixer 23, the top of mixing tube 21 is equipped with plus bacterium mouthful 24, and bacterium device 22 is added to be connected with bacterium mouthful 24 is added.It uses When, the sewage come from the bacterium solution and the pumping of sewage pump 1 for adding the conveying of bacterium device 22 is filled in mixing tube 21 by pipe-line mixer 23 Divide mixing, enhances the effect of biochemical reaction.
Mixing sedimentation unit includes reaction chamber, partition 25 is vertically provided in reaction chamber, partition 25 separates reaction chamber At aerobic aeration room 26 and sludge settling room 27, partition 25 is equipped with the channel of connection aerobic aeration room 26 and sludge settling room 27 28, the bottom of aerobic aeration room 26 is equipped with micro-hole aerator 29, and the outside of aerobic aeration room 26 is equipped with air blower 210, air blast Machine 210 is connected with micro-hole aerator 29, is equipped with sludge reflux pump 211 in sludge settling room 27, sludge reflux pump 211 with Aerobic aeration room 26 is connected, and water inlet pipe 33 is extended in sludge settling room by the top of sludge settling room 27, water inlet pipe 33 Bottom end is located at the top in channel 28.In use, in well-mixed sewage transport to aerobic solarization air cell 26, air blower 210 is to micro- Air is blasted in hole aerator 29, reacts activated sludge, microbial inoculum and sewage sufficiently by aeration, the sewage for reacting completion passes through Channel 28 enters in sludge settling room 27, and after the precipitating of certain time, sludge sinks to the bottom of sludge settling room 27, water by Water inlet pipe 33 is evacuated to filter assemblies 3 under the action of booster pump 34, sludge by backflow of slurry pump reflux to aerobic solarization air cell 26 after Continuous reaction, the top that channel 28 is arranged in water inlet pipe 33, which avoids, is evacuated to sludge in filter assemblies 3, improves purification efficiency.
It includes water purification drinking-water pipe 41 that water purification, which detaches component 4, and water purification drinking-water pipe 41 is run through by the top of water-purifying tank 31 into water purification Bucket 31, and extend into water-purifying tank 31, the lower end of water purification drinking-water pipe 41 and the bottom interval of water-purifying tank 31 are arranged, water purification drinking-water pipe Suction pump 42 is installed on 41.In use, water purification is detached water-purifying tank 31 by water purification drinking-water pipe 41 by suction pump 42, after filtering Water have partial impurities precipitating after standing, the bottom interval of the lower end of water purification drinking-water pipe 41 and water-purifying tank 31 is arranged and can keep away Exempt from the impurity that will be precipitated extraction, further ensures the pure of water.
Tubular filter net is set in spiral filtration pipe 32.Wherein, tubular filter net can take out from spiral filtration pipe 32, The cleaning of spiral filtration pipe 32 is convenient in this setting.
Spiral filtration pipe 32 is suppressed by active carbon.Wherein, numerous lax holes are contained in active carbon, are had very strong Adsorptivity, have good adsorption effect to the impurity in water quality, active carbon compacting helically increased into active carbon and water Contact area, optimize adsorption effect.
The top of water-purifying tank 31 is equipped with venthole 35, is equipped with air filtering core 36 on venthole 35.Wherein, air filtering core 36 Setting ensure that air pressure is identical as the external world in water-purifying tank 31, and extraneous pollutant can be isolated and enter water-purifying tank 31, avoid outer The secondary pollution of boundary's water.
The bottom of water-purifying tank 31 is equipped with sewage draining exit 36, is equipped with valve 37 on sewage draining exit 36.Wherein, filtered water is stood The precipitating generated afterwards is discharged by sewage draining exit 36.
Working principle is:
Step 1: sewage pump 1 is put into sewage by staff, sewage is pumped into mixing tube 21 by sewage pump 1, meanwhile, Add bacterium device 22 to mix and bet microbial inoculum in pipe 21, sewage and microbial inoculum are sufficiently mixed under the action of pipe-line mixer 23, then It injects in aerobic aeration room 26, air blower 210 blasts air into micro-hole aerator 29, makes activated sludge, microbial inoculum by aeration It is sufficiently reacted with sewage, the sewage for reacting completion enters in sludge settling room 27 by channel 28, by the precipitating of certain time Afterwards, sludge sinks to the bottom of sludge settling room 27, and the water on top is pumped into spiral filtration pipe by water inlet pipe 33 by booster pump 34 32;
Step 2: sewage is subject to centrifugal forces in spiral filtration pipe 32 under the action of booster pump 34, water purification from It is thrown away in spiral filtration pipe 32 and flows into water-purifying tank 31, the sundries in water stays in spiral filtration pipe 32, and filtered water purification is by taking out Water pump 42 extracts water-purifying tank 31 out, uses for elsewhere.
